Transaction 753260bb5901773e66d60048db4d74f749811c253281c29da395bcc0faec2408

2 Input
2 Outputs
  • 753260bb5901773e66d60048db4d74f749811c253281c29da395bcc0faec2408:0
  • value  1143292
    address  1NHVSY18fPGTgNoERMdxoy4sJqVZGupbpZ
  • 753260bb5901773e66d60048db4d74f749811c253281c29da395bcc0faec2408:1
  • value  11023
    address  17arUuosHZqrWMMkxWkLPBkVAc9FV1nTYQ